HarmonyOS flutter使用shared_preferences,编译失败

flutter引入shared_preferences库,编译失败。

编译文件出现下面错误

lib/main.dart:9:8: Error: Error when reading '/C:/Users/xxxx/AppData/Local/Pub/Cache/git/flutter_packages-7358e4ba062b6fa779ab2cf37ad2122a6772c379/packages/shared_preferences/shared_preferences/lib/shared_preferences.dart': 

系统找不到指定的路径。

import 'package:shared_preferences/shared_preferences.dart';
HarmonyOS
1天前
浏览
收藏 0
回答 1
待解决
回答 1
按赞同
/
按时间
Excelsior_abit

是windows环境pub cache默认的路径太长了,需要设置短一点的路径,创建文件,修改环境变量 PUB_CACHE = D:\cache\pub,重启IDE或终端后再编译运行。

分享
微博
QQ
微信
回复
23h前
相关问题
HarmonyOS 使用hvigorw编译失败
219浏览 • 1回复 待解决
HarmonyOS 编译flutter报错
247浏览 • 1回复 待解决
HarmonyOS 使用集成态 HSP 时,编译失败
140浏览 • 1回复 待解决
HarmonyOS 编译失败问题
316浏览 • 1回复 待解决
HarmonyOS 引入har编译失败
42浏览 • 1回复 待解决
HarmonyOS XCode 15.3无法编译flutter engine
220浏览 • 1回复 待解决
编译release包失败
403浏览 • 1回复 待解决
HarmonyOS 使用preferences存储的限制
496浏览 • 1回复 待解决
HarmonyOS RN empty project编译失败
319浏览 • 1回复 待解决
HarmonyOS windows系统下编译失败
461浏览 • 0回复 待解决
HarmonyOS ndk编译mars库失败
687浏览 • 1回复 待解决
HarmonyOS 新增申请权限编译失败
159浏览 • 1回复 待解决
HarmonyOS react-native应用编译失败
139浏览 • 1回复 待解决